Limitless co-stars Abbie Cornish and Bradley Cooper are featured in the April 2011 issue of Marie Claire.
In the issue Bradley talks about their chemistry in the film, literally from the get-go:
“The first scene we shot together was probably the most difficult in the movie. Eddie’s at his lowest in terms of getting off the drug, and Abbie and I had only just met the day before, so it was like, Bam! I’m falling all over her, and she’s cradling me. I think we were able to bond because all we really had was each other in that experience.”
Bradley and Abbie talk about their first dates:
Abbie: “I believe mine was under the modular buildings in primary school. In year one or two, when I was 6 or 7. I remember crawling along the ground and meeting the boy there; it was dark, and we were nestled in the dirt. There were no kisses, a lot of silence. I think he may have pinched me … then the school bell rang.”
Bradley: “The first date I ever went on was in Ocean City, New Jersey. I was 13, and I took this girl I knew to a seafood restaurant on the boardwalk and ordered clams on the half shell — not really a great first-date meal. I was dressed like such a dork, plus it’s not very appealing to watch your date suck down 24 raw clams on a hot summer night, but that’s how I laid it on.”
